Searching an input signal
1.
Press SEARCH button on the remote control.
The projector will start to check its input ports as below in
order to fi nd any input signals.
When an input is found, the projector will stop searching
and display the image. If no signal is found, the projector will
return to the state selected before the operation.

● While ON is selected for AUTO SEARCH item in OPTION menu (53), the
projector will keep checking the ports in above order repeatedly till an input
signal is detected.
● It may take several seconds to project the images from the USB TYPE B port.
Selecting an aspect ratio
1.
Press ASPECT button on the remote control.
Each time you press the button, the projector switches the
mode for aspect ratio in turn.
For a computer signal
CPX10WN/CPX11WN: NORMAL 4:3 16:9 16:10
CPWX12WN: NORMAL 4:3 16:9 16:10 NATIVE
For an HDMI
CPX10WN/CPX11WN: NORMAL 4:3 16:9 16:10 14:9
CPWX12WN: NORMAL 4:3 16:9 16:10 14:9 NATIVE
For a video signal, s-video signal or component video signal
CPX10WN/CPX11WN: 4:3 16:9 14:9
CPWX12WN: 4:3 16:9 14:9 NATIVE
For an input signal from the LAN, USB TYPE A or USB TYPE B port, or
if there is no signal
CPX10WN/CPX11WN: 4:3 (fi xed) CPWX12WN: 16:10 (fi xed)
● ASPECT button does not work when no proper signal is inputted.
● NORMAL mode keeps the original aspect ratio setting.
